I Love Thor Donating Member | Frontline not working...reapply? Hey guys, Thor got his monthly flea and tick treatment last week. Well...he's been itching like crazy AND I found at least three fleas on him and a tick. So what's the deal? Should I reapply? He's not a happy boy, but I don't want to OD him on flea stuff...Thanks We use Frontline Plus. |

| With most flea meds you can reapply every 2 weeks but I am not sure about frontline plus, I would ask your vet first. Did you bath him right after you applied and it washed off?? I had frontline plus before and it didn't work good for us. So now I either use advantage or revolution and they have all been flea and tick free for a very long time. Of course with fleas I prefer advantage. With had a huge problem years ago, about 8 years ago, we had to get a flea bomb but what really helped was the advantage, it really got rid of the fleas. I really like the flea and tick meds. that kills fleas instantly rather than the flea meds where the flea has to bite the dog first. I would ask your vet why it might not have worked and if necessary switch flea medicine.

| hi, im new to the forum and would like to gather and share information about yorkies. iv been using frontline for my yorkie and i never had a problem with it. it did clear up his flea/tick problem. accdg to our vet, the best way to apply frontline is to give my yorkie a bath. then after 2 days, apply frontline and leave it on for a week. this is supposed to maximize the effect of frontline. hope this helps. |
